🙌 Your Mission

As a Finance Associate at NALA, you will play a crucial role in supporting the finance team with day to day operations and ensuring the smooth reconciliation processing.

🎯 Your Responsibilities in this Role

  • Perform daily reconciliations between internal systems and partner accounts
  • Investigate and resolve reconciliation discrepancies or issues escalating complex cases appropriately
  • Ensure precise reconciliation records are kept and generate reports as needed.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ams including Treasury, Operations, and Compliance
  • Perform verification & processing of provider invoices & charges
  • Support the finance & data team on reconciliations automation project(s)
  • Support process improvements to increase efficiency and accuracy in finance operations
  • Other duties as assigned periodically.

✅ Success in the role looks like

3-Month Metrics

By day 90, the associate fully owns daily transactional processes, understanding the underlying data trends. They autonomously manage daily reconciliations between internal ledgers and payment partners, accurately flagging discrepancies. Utilizing SQL, they efficiently investigate transaction issues and verify provider invoices and fees to prevent overpayments. They collaborate effectively across Treasury, Operations, and Compliance to resolve anomalies.

6-Month Metrics

By day 180, the associate drives automation efforts using SQL to reduce manual tasks. They contribute to finance and data team projects to automate reconciliation, optimize workflows, and streamline invoice verification. They independently resolve complex discrepancies and partner with product and engineering teams to address root causes.
